首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库服务器配置规划

是指在构建和运维数据库环境时,根据需求和性能要求确定服务器硬件和软件配置的过程。下面是一个完善且全面的答案:

数据库服务器配置规划的目标是确保数据库系统能够以高效、稳定和安全的方式运行,并能满足业务需求。配置规划应综合考虑以下因素:

  1. 硬件配置:
    • 处理器:选择性能强劲、核心数多的处理器,以提供较高的计算能力和并发处理能力。
    • 内存:配置足够的内存,以便数据库系统能够存储和处理大量的数据,提高查询和计算性能。
    • 存储设备:选择高速的存储设备,如固态硬盘(SSD),以提供快速的数据读写能力。
    • 网络:配置高速的网络接口,确保数据库服务器与其他系统之间的数据传输效率。
  • 软件配置:
    • 操作系统:选择适合的操作系统,如Linux、Windows Server等,根据数据库厂商建议的操作系统版本选择合适的版本。
    • 数据库软件:选择适合的数据库软件,如MySQL、Oracle、SQL Server等,根据业务需求、数据规模和性能要求进行选择。
    • 数据库参数配置:根据数据库的性能和安全要求,对数据库软件的配置参数进行优化和调整,以获得更好的性能和安全性。
  • 高可用性和容灾:
    • 数据库复制:配置主从复制或主主复制,提供数据的冗余备份和高可用性。
    • 故障转移和故障恢复:使用故障转移和故障恢复技术,确保在数据库服务器故障时能够及时切换到备用服务器,并迅速恢复服务。
    • 数据备份和恢复:配置定期备份策略,将数据库的数据和日志进行备份,以便在数据丢失或损坏时能够进行及时恢复。
  • 安全性:
    • 访问控制:配置合适的访问控制机制,限制对数据库的访问权限,确保只有授权的用户能够访问和操作数据库。
    • 数据加密:配置数据加密技术,对敏感数据进行加密存储和传输,提高数据的安全性。
    • 审计和监控:配置审计和监控机制,记录数据库的访问和操作日志,及时发现和应对安全事件。

数据库服务器配置规划的应用场景包括各类企业和组织的信息管理系统、电子商务平台、物流系统、在线教育平台等需要存储和管理大量数据的业务系统。

推荐的腾讯云相关产品:腾讯云数据库(TencentDB)系列产品,包括云数据库 MySQL版、云数据库 PostgreSQL版、云数据库 MariaDB版、云数据库 Redis版等。这些产品提供了高可用性、弹性扩展、备份与恢复、数据加密等功能,满足不同场景下的数据库需求。

详细产品介绍和链接地址:

注意:本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的一些云计算品牌商,以符合要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券